Team leaders Stephen Crichton, Jarome Luai and Adam Reynolds headline the list of players pushing to return from injury across a big weekend of footy.
Crichton has been named in the reserves for Canterbury's clash with the Eels, while Luai and Reynolds are set to face off when the Wests Tigers host the Broncos in a Saturday-night showdown at Campbelltown Sports Stadium.
A full house is expected, with Luai on track to start at five-eighth for the Tigers and Reynolds returning from a groin injury for Brisbane.
Following further medical assessment by an independent specialist, Broncos hooker Cory Paix will remain unavailable after suffering a head knock last week.

Cowboys: Reed Mahoney's bid to recover from a head knock has fallen short, with Soni Luke to start at hooker. Braidon Burns is on track to return from an ankle injury that forced him to miss last week's win over Brisbane. The winger will replace Murray Taulagi, who also suffered a head knock in Round 6. Scott Drinkwater will play his 150th game for the Cowboys.
Sea Eagles: Lock Jake Trbojevic is on track to take his place in the team despite suffering a nasty cut that forced him to lose vision in his right eye last week. Prop Siosiua Taukeiaho is also set to complete his comeback from a calf injury that has sidelined him since Round 1. Winger Jason Saab has scored six tries in his last three games against the Cowboys.

Raiders: Centre Matt Timoko is set for his first match since Round 2 as Ricky Stuart rejigs his backline for Friday night's crucial clash with the Storm. Seb Kris moves to the wing as a result and Savelio Tamale has dropped back to the reserves. Josh Papalii and Noah Martin have been named to start but could revert to the interchange on game day, as they did last week.
Storm: Manaia Watere is set to start on the wing after Moses Leo shifted to the reserves. No other changes to the starting side as Melbourne battle to avoid five-straight losses for the first time since 2012.

Dolphins: Brad Schneider is set to play a role off the bench after Kurt Donoghoe was ruled out with injury. Schneider wore No.14 in the Dolphins loss to Manly prior to last week's bye, but coach Kristian Woolf opted to inject Donoghoe into the contest instead. Jeremy Marshall-King also remains sidelined as he slowly works his way back to fitness from a knee injury.
Panthers: Izack Tago is set for his first chance in the top flight this season and will start in the centres in place of the suspended Casey McLean. It will be Tago's 100th NRL appearance. Penrith have been dealt a big blow with Liam Martin ruled out with a knee injury. The representative forward will be replaced by Luke Garner in the starting side, with Kalani Going the new face on the bench.

Warriors: Star prop Mitchell Barnett is an outside chance of making an early comeback from a fractured thumb and has been listed on the reserves alongside Charnze Nicoll-Klokstad, who is hoping to return from a neck injury. No such luck for Tanner Stowers-Smith, who succumbs to a hamstring injury but Kurt Capewell is on track to return from a calf injury and will line up in the back row.
Titans: Prop Klese Haas is pushing to return from a quad injury that forced him to miss last week's big win over the Eels and remains in the extended squad. No other changes for a Titans team chasing back-to-back away wins for the first time since 2023.

Rabbitohs: Former Dragon Matt Dufty is set for his first NRL game since Round 12, 2022 after receiving clearance to replace injured fullback Jye Gray in the No.1 jersey. South Sydney have also been dealt a blow with the loss of David Fifita to a hamstring injury. Lachlan Hubner comes into the back row. Latrell Mitchell has scored 12 tries in 10 games at Accor Stadium.
Dragons: The loss of Moses Suli to a fractured eye socket will see Mat Feagai start in the centres for the first time this year, having come off the bench on three occasions. Coach Shane Flanagan could also turn to a crop of youngsters as the Dragons chase their first win of the year, with Jacob Halangahu and Kade Reed listed on the six-man bench. Winger Christian Tuipulotu is also on track to take his place in the side despite leaving the field with a knee injury last week.

Wests Tigers: Co-captain Jarome Luai will take his place in the team provided he passes a fitness test later this week, while the Tigers are also set to welcome back centre Taylan May for his first game since suffering a shoulder injury in Round 1. Samuela Fainu is on track to line up despite leaving last week's win over Newcastle with a knee injury. Tony Sukkar will likely come on to the bench if Fainu is ruled out.
Broncos: Adam Reynolds is on track to make his return from a groin injury after missing last week's tight loss to the Cowboys. Xavier Willison is set to start at lock in place of suspended co-captain Pat Carrigan, while 29-year-old hooker Josh Rogers is set for his first NRL game since 2024 after Cory Paix (head knock) was ruled out following further medical assessment by an independent specialist. Youngster Cameron Bukowski could also be in line for an NRL debut following a strong start to the Q Cup season with Wynnum Manly.

Roosters: Centre Billy Smith is pushing to return from a knee injury suffered in Round 4 and remains in the reserves for Sunday's clash. Hugo Savala will likely be the man to drop out if Smith returns to the fold. The Roosters are otherwise settled as they chase their third-straight victory.
Knights: Star recruit Dylan Brown is on track to complete his comeback from a knee injury suffered in Round 2 and will line up in the No.7 jersey alongside five-eighth Sandon Smith. Brown's return will force Fletcher Sharpe to shift to fullback and Fletcher Hunt into the centres as coach Justin Holbrook continues to navigate the absence of Kalyn Ponga and Bradman Best. Back-rower Thomas Cant is set to start in Dylan Lucas' place after the forward suffered a nasty throat injury, with Tyson Frizell (ribs) also unavailable.

Eels: Sean Russell is on track to return from a concussion as the Eels continue to deal with an overflowing casualty ward. The centre's return will see Brian Kelly shift to the wing, however Kelma Tuilagi and Sam Tuivaiti have both been ruled out due to head knocks. Jack Williams and Charlie Guymer are the new starting back-rowers, with debutant Saxon Pryke and Toni Mataele the new faces on the bench.
Bulldogs: Inspirational skipper Stephen Crichton is pushing for a shock comeback from a shoulder injury suffered on Good Friday and remains in the extended squad for Sunday's game. Crichton's return would see either Enari Tuala or Bronson Xerri shift to the reserves. New recruit Leo Thompson is also set for his first game for the Bulldogs after recovering from a calf injury suffered in the pre-season. Josh Curran remains in the mix to return from a leg injury suffered in Round 4 and is listed in the reserves alongside Crichton.
